Frequently Asked Questions

Is Montevideo cheaper than Berlin?

Montevideo is cheaper than Berlin. Montevideo has a cost of living index of 31/100 compared to 35/100 for Berlin (New York = 100), making it roughly 10% more affordable overall.

How much cheaper is Montevideo than Berlin?

Montevideo is approximately 10% cheaper than Berlin based on cost index scores (31 vs 35, where New York = 100). A person spending $3,000/month in Berlin could live a similar lifestyle for roughly $2,710/month in Montevideo.

What is the rent comparison between Montevideo and Berlin?

In Montevideo, a 1-bedroom apartment in the city center costs approximately $800/month. In Berlin, the equivalent is around $1,533/month.

Which city is better for digital nomads — Montevideo or Berlin?

Both cities have nomad infrastructure. Montevideo offers 75 Mbps internet and coworking at ~$280/month. Berlin offers 109 Mbps and coworking at ~$250/month. Montevideo has a cost advantage of 10%.

What is the average income in Montevideo vs Berlin?

The median net monthly salary in Montevideo is approximately $1,100 USD, compared to $2,900 USD in Berlin.
